相关文章
【优选算法】栈 {何时使用栈结构?后缀表达式求值;中缀转后缀表达式;中缀表达式求值}
一、经验总结
何时使用栈结构解题?
做过相似的使用栈结构解得的题目嵌套处理:在从前向后处理的过程中,由于之后内容的不确定性而导致当前操作不能贸然进行,需要先进行保存,直到遇到区间结束标志(如’)&am…
建站知识
2024/12/25 6:18:12
Golang:使用Base64Captcha生成数字字母验证码实现安全校验
Base64Captcha可以在服务端生成验证码,以base64的格式返回
为了能看到生成的base64验证码图片,我们借助gin
go get -u github.com/mojocn/base64Captcha
go get -u github.com/gin-gonic/gin文档的示例看起来很复杂,下面,通过简…
建站知识
2024/12/25 18:08:29
【LeetCode】使括号有效的最少添加
题目链接: 921. 使括号有效的最少添加 - 力扣(LeetCode)
对于一个只有()组合的括号字符串,如果想要这个字符串是有效的括号对,找出最少需要插入多少个括号
括号离不开栈,栈可以消除…
建站知识
2024/12/25 18:03:18
Vector容器详解
Vector容器详解
本文将详细介绍C#中的Vector容器,包括其定义、特点、使用方法以及示例代码。
目录
Vector容器简介Vector容器的特点Vector容器的使用方法示例代码
1. Vector容器简介
Vector容器是一种动态数组,它可以自动调整大小以容纳更多的元素。…
建站知识
2024/12/25 18:08:17
【C/C++】C语言实现std::move
C语言中的模拟 std::move
在C中,std::move 用于将一个对象转换为右值引用,以便可以使用移动语义。在C语言中,我们可以通过传递指针来模拟这种行为。
#include <stdio.h>
#include <stdlib.h>typedef struct {int *data;
} Arra…
建站知识
2024/12/25 18:08:09